Ogden is a city in Riley County, Kansas, United States. As of the 2010 census, the city population was 2,087.[6]

Ogden was founded about 1857.[7] It was named for Major E. A. Ogden of the Army Corps of Engineers, a leader in building Fort Riley nearby.[8][9][10] Ogden was incorporated as a city in 1870.[7]

It is necessary to act quick when handling house water damage. Mold and mildew can start growing in as low as 24 hours if the water is left standing. To dry out the affected area, take as much out of the space, including furnishings, and location fans on the wet flooring and walls.

As soon as whatever has been gotten rid of from the enclosure and fans have been triggered to begin the drying process, we advise carrying out an inspection of your home to verify if there are covert areas they may require water damage repair work. Check under floorboards and the cushioning below carpet to see if water has permeated these areas.

Once everything is dry, search for areas of water damage in your house where mold might have started growing. If mold is found, take care. Some mold can be poisonous and harmful to humans. If it is a small mold issue, you may be able to carefully look after it yourself.

If you observe water damage to walls, carpet, wood, or other porous materials in your house, you will be needed to remove and replace them. If you discover carpet or wood that will not require comprehensive water damage repair work, you may have the ability to conserve particular locations by drying them out ASAP.

A basic bleach service should work. Be sure to also disinfect any items that remained in the affected area to make sure any mold or germs is gotten rid of. If your roofing system or siding is not correctly sealed, you may need to handle a costly water damage repair task from excess wetness.

To remove future repair jobs caused by moderate to serious water damage, we recommend sealing and caulking new windows, pipes fixtures, flooring, and entrances. With record droughts afflicting parts of the United States, fire is becoming an all-too-common threat for property owners. Should your home get caught in an out-of-control wildfire or fall victim to a more common kitchen area or electrical fire, you’ll wish to contact a home fire restoration specialist and take your own action to remediate the damage.

According to the Institute of Evaluation Cleaning and Repair Certification (IICRC), certified fire repair services have the capability to assist even in the most severe cases. The primary step in remediating the fire damage is a full-blown tidy up, and a specialist will have the correct devices, suitable cleaning products, manpower, and, most importantly, know-how to do the task correctly and thoroughly.

Wood, among the most flammable products in a home fire, produces smoke which contains methane, carbon monoxide gas, sulfur dioxide, and heavy metals. Acidic ash residue needs to be removed within a couple of days. Walls, ceilings, floorings every part of the house affected by the fire needs to be dealt with. Ash is acidic and if left for too long will trigger materials to deteriorate.
